What is an MBA for Working Professionals?
An MBA for working professionals is a specially designed management program that allows individuals to study while maintaining their jobs. Unlike traditional full-time MBA programs, it offers flexible learning formats such as weekend classes, online sessions, or hybrid models.
These programs focus on practical learning, real-world case studies, and skill development, making them highly relevant in today’s industry landscape.
MBA Eligibility Criteria
Understanding mba eligibility is essential before applying. While requirements may differ between institutions, most programs in India follow some common criteria.
Applicants typically need a bachelor’s degree from a recognized university with minimum qualifying marks. Some programs prefer candidates with work experience, but many also accept fresh graduates who want to build a strong foundation in management.
The flexible eligibility criteria make this program accessible to a wide range of learners.

Popular MBA Specializations
Choosing the right mba specializations is crucial for shaping your career path. Some of the most popular options include Travel & Tourism, Marketing, Digital Marketing, Human Resources, and FinTech.
Travel & Tourism is ideal for those interested in hospitality and global industries. Marketing focuses on branding and business growth strategies, while Digital Marketing is perfect for those looking to build a career in the online space.
Human Resources suits individuals who enjoy managing people and organizational culture. FinTech is an emerging field that combines finance with technology, offering strong career potential in digital finance and innovation.
